#740594 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#740594 is composed of 45.5% red, 2%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.6% cyan, 96.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 286.6 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 30%. #740594 color hex could be obtained by blending #e80aff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#740594

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c010f is the darkest color, while #fefb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#740594

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4c4d is the less saturated color, while #740594 is the most saturated one.
